#e6aa2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6aa2e is composed of 90.2% red, 66.7%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 80%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 40.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 54.1%. #e6aa2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#cd5500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e6aa2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6aa2e has RGB values of R:230, G:170,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.8,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15116846.

Shades and Tints of #e6aa2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fdf8ef is the lightest one.
